One of the things we love about our quizzes is that it’s not just about getting the answers right – we also learn fascinating facts along the way. For example, did you know the famous black chair on Mastermind was designed by Swedish designer Fritz Hansen? It’s called the ‘Swivel Chair 300’, and was chosen by the show’s creator, Bill Wright, who was inspired by interrogations he experienced as a POW during WWII.
